The Car

The third-generation Clio Cup 197 was introduced to succeed the second-generation 182 model, which was utilised between 2002 and 2006.

The main change to the car during the spell came halfway through 2009, when the facelifted Clio Cup 200 model was introduced. (As seen above)

The car has remained the same by and large since then, with the 200 model still being used into this season – the main difference coming from a change to Dunlop tyres at the start of this season after years using Michelin rubber.
